Pakistan Masters TT
KARACHI, Sept 17: The last leg of the Pakistan Masters table tennis circuit will be staged at Peshawar from Nov 15 to 17, immediately after completion of third Inter-provincial games in the capital of NWFP.
Top 32 men and as many women are to vie for honours in the singles and team events.
The circuit which provides fierce competition to players was re-launched by the Pakistan Table Tennis Federation (PTTF) at Karachi in March this year. Wapda ‘A’ and Habib Bank ‘A’ won the men’s and women’s team events titles respectively.
Internationals Saleem Abbas landed the men’s singles crown while the women’s singles title went to Sadia Falaksher.
Meanwhile, the domestic activities of the calendar will be rounded off when Lahore play host to the National Table Tennis Championship in December.—Sports Correspondent
